Abstract
The Katz hand diagram is a rapid and non-invasive screening tool utilized primarily for the diagnosis of Carpal Tunnel Syndrome (CTS). The procedure involves presenting the patient with a diagram illustrating both hands and arms. The patient is then instructed to accurately mark the specific locations of their symptoms, differentiating between various types of discomfort, including stiffness, pain, tingling, and sensory disturbances or numbness. The resulting drawing is subsequently classified by the clinician into one of three standardized diagnostic categories: Pattern A (Classic), Pattern B (Probable), and Pattern C (Unlikely), allowing for a quick clinical assessment of median nerve involvement.

Purpose
The primary purpose of the Katz hand diagram is to serve as an efficient, low-cost screening instrument for identifying patients likely suffering from Carpal Tunnel Syndrome (CTS). It provides a visual and quantifiable method for documenting the distribution of subjective sensory complaints, which is crucial for distinguishing CTS from other causes of hand and wrist pain or paresthesia.
This diagram is frequently used in primary care settings and specialized clinics before more expensive or invasive diagnostic procedures, such as electrodiagnostic studies (nerve conduction tests), are considered. Its simplicity allows for rapid administration and immediate clinical interpretation regarding the likelihood of median nerve entrapment at the wrist.
Construct
The central construct measured by the Katz hand diagram is the typical distribution pattern of sensory symptoms resulting from median nerve compression within the carpal tunnel. The classification system relies on the anatomical principle that CTS symptoms usually affect the median nerve territory distal to the wrist, often sparing the palmar cutaneous branch.
The instrument categorizes the patient’s symptomatic distribution based on how closely it aligns with known anatomical patterns of median nerve involvement. Pattern A (Classic) indicates a high probability of CTS by showing symptoms localized to the median nerve distribution, while Pattern C (Unlikely) suggests an alternative diagnosis, such as cervical radiculopathy or ulnar nerve pathology, as the source of the patient’s discomfort.
Validity
The clinical validity of the Katz hand diagram is generally high, particularly when used as a screening tool. Studies have consistently demonstrated strong correlation between a “Classic” (Pattern A) or “Probable” (Pattern B) drawing and positive findings on definitive electrodiagnostic testing for Carpal Tunnel Syndrome.
Specifically, the diagram exhibits high sensitivity (often exceeding 80%) in identifying true positive cases of CTS. While its specificity can vary depending on the patient population, it remains a valuable tool for differentiating CTS from non-specific hand pain or other forms of peripheral nervous system disorders affecting the upper extremity. The high predictive value of the Classic pattern confirms its utility in clinical screening.
Reliability
The reliability of the Katz hand diagram is primarily assessed through inter-rater reliability, focusing on the consistency with which different clinicians classify the patient-drawn patterns. Early research indicated good to excellent inter-rater agreement (Kappa values often above 0.70) when clinicians apply the standardized classification rules defined by Katz and Stirrat.
Furthermore, test-retest reliability is considered acceptable, provided the patient’s symptoms remain stable between administrations. The primary source of variability is usually the patient’s ability to accurately map their symptoms, rather than the clinician’s interpretation of the resulting pattern. The defined classification criteria minimize subjective interpretation, contributing to its robust clinical reliability.
Factor Analysis
Traditional psychometric factor analysis is not typically applied to the Katz hand diagram, as it is a clinical classification tool rather than a multi-item psychometric scale designed to measure latent variables. Instead of factor loading, its structure is based on established anatomical and physiological patterns of nerve distribution.
The “factor structure” is inherent in the three outcome categories (A, B, C), which represent distinct clinical manifestations correlating with the likelihood of median nerve entrapment. This categorical structure serves as the basis for its diagnostic utility, effectively grouping symptom distributions based on their pathological relevance to Carpal Tunnel Syndrome.

Permissions & Fee and Test Year
The Katz hand diagram was introduced in 1990 by Katz and Stirrat. As a simple, non-proprietary diagnostic tool frequently reproduced in medical literature, the diagram itself is generally free for clinical use, though formal permission may be required for large-scale commercial reproduction or modification.
